Python中控制語句__Python

淺析概念 while迴圈 import randomsecret=int(random.uniform(0,10))print("我想的數字在0到10之間,猜猜吧。")guess=11while guess!=secret: guess=int(input("輸入猜的數字吧。"))print("Well Done!") 結果: 我想的數字在0到10之間,猜猜吧。輸入猜的數字吧。3輸入猜的數字吧。2輸入猜的數字吧。1

python基本 迭代__python

From:http://www.liaoxuefeng.com/wiki/001374738125095c955c1e6d8bb493182103fac9270762a000/0013868196435255fcca20a1630446ea2dd434a7176e152000 dict預設迭代key >>> d = {'a': 1, 'b': 2, 'c': 3}>>> for key in d:... print key...acb

Python相關文章索引(12)__Python

基本常識 Python多級排序(多屬性排序)csv檔案 python re的findall和finditer pythonRegex提取所有小括弧裡的字串 python的sorted函數對字典按key排序和按value排序 python中的字元數字之間的轉換函式 python字典的get函數和iteritems函數 Python strip()方法 Python strip()

python實現楊輝三角(使用產生器generator)__python

 楊輝三角定義如下 1 1 1 1 2 1 1 3 3 1 1 4 6 4 11 5 10 10 5 1 #將楊輝三角的每一行看成一個list,寫一個產生器(generator),不斷輸出下一行list def triangel(n):     L=[1]            

Python擷取本機外網IP__Python

1. 開啟https://www.baidu.com/ 2. 輸入ip, 進行搜尋, 擷取url http://cn.bing.com/search?q=ip&go=%E6%8F%90%E4%BA%A4&qs=n&form=QBLH&pq=ip&sc=8-2&sp=-1&sk=&cvid=14b93b305cdc4183875411c3d9edf938 3. 尋找url返回結果  

列印楊輝三角(廖雪峰python教程)__python

廖雪峰 python教程  產生器章節,有一道楊輝的題目。 楊輝三角定義如下: 1 1 1 1 2 1 1 3 3 1 1 4 6 4 11 5 10 10 5 1 把每一行看做一個list,試寫一個generator,不斷輸出下一行的list: def triangles(): L=[1] while True: yield

Python邏輯操作符__Python

剛開始看python,覺得這個邏輯操作符和其他語言有些區別,所以就記錄下來。 Python的邏輯操作有三種:and、or、not。分別對應與、或、非。 嚴格的說,邏輯操作符的運算元應該為布林運算式。但Python對此處理的比較靈活。 即使運算元是數字,解譯器也把他們當成“運算式”。 非0的數位布爾值為1,0的布爾值為0. 在Python中,Null 字元串為假,非Null 字元串為真。非零的數為真。 對於and操作符a and b:

python的GUI編程(Tkinter庫)(三)

訊息(message) 訊息控制項提供了顯示多行文本的方法,且可以設定字型和背景顏色 樣本: from Tkinter import *root=Tk()root.title('top')Message(root,text='you can record your wonderful thing ,you can record your wonderful thing ',\ bg='blue',fg='ivory',relief=GROOVE).pack(padx=10

hihocoder:#1148 : 2月29日,python版本__python

計算到某年為止的閏年數,其實很簡單.設要計算的年為A,則到A年為止(含A年)的閏年數為:閏年數=INT(A/4)-INT(A/100)+INT(A/400) 這裡:INT為取整數函數 #-*-coding:utf-8-*-'''@author : liuhuitingDate : 2016年8月31日Description :計算到某年為止的閏年數,其實很簡單.設要計算的年為A,則到A年為止(含A年)的閏年數為:閏年數=INT(A/4)-INT(A/100)+INT(A/400)

Python學習筆記(3)——邏輯關係__Python

條件陳述式 if 判斷條件: 執行語句……else: 執行語句…… if 判斷條件1: 執行語句1……elif 判斷條件2: 執行語句2……elif 判斷條件3: 執行語句3……else: 執行語句4…… 迴圈語句 while 判斷條件: 執行語句…… 兩個重要命令:continue 用於跳過該次迴圈,break 則是用於退出迴圈。嵌套迴圈情況下,break將退出最深層的迴圈語句。pass為空白語句,用來佔位。

python中的字串切片__python

1.切片操作符在python中的原型 [start:stop:step] 即:[開始索引:結束索引:步長值] 開始索引:同其它語言一樣,從0開始。序列從左向右方向中,第一個值的索引為0,最後一個為-1 結束索引:切片操作符將取到該索引為止,不包含該索引的值。 步長值:預設是一個接著一個切取,如果為2,則表示進行隔一取一操作。步長值為正時表示從左向右取,如果為負,則表示從右向左取。步長值不能為0 註明:如果是string[ : ]的模式,那麼就是[start:

send mail by SMTP server (Python)__Python

python發送郵件,smtp伺服器用新浪 import smtplibFROMADDR = "anit_nait@sina.com"LOGIN = FROMADDRPASSWORD = "xxxxxx"TOADDRS = ["xxx@sina.com","xxx@hpe.com"]SUBJECT = "hello world from smtp.sina.com

python 學習筆記(一)通過做題來熟悉python 的基本文法__python

codeforces 208-A 將原字串中的“WUB”子串去掉 s = input()a = s.split('WUB')for t in a: if t!='': print(t,end=' ') 1. input input進來的是string,如果要讀一個數位話,要用int()轉為數字 int( input() ) 2. a = s.split(str) 將原串 按str進行分割,然後存到的到子串存到一個集合當中 eg: s

《python核心編程》序列:字串、列表和元組Python: Attribute Error - 'NoneType' object has no attribute

摘要:在python中,有一種資料類型,它的成員是有序排列的,可以通過下標位移量訪問,稱之為“序列”,包括字串、列表、元組。我們主要從簡介、操作符、內建函數、特性、相關模組等方面來學習這些序列。 本文來源:《python核心編程》序列:字串、列表和元組 1.序列 序列類型操作符: seq[index],seq[index1:index2],seq*expr,seq1+seq2,obj in seq,obj not in seq序列類型工廠轉化函數: list(iter),str(obj)

python的list和dict是否是安全執行緒的討論__python

在 今天code一個python的多線程代碼,因為需要多個線程共用同一個dict,遇到一個困惑,就是dict是否是安全執行緒的,去華莽裡面查了下,發現有大牛在討論,因此記錄下,具體還需要我去進一步驗證下: twisted的代碼中,是把dict和list當做安全執行緒來使用的,但是dict和list在jython中不是線程案全的,所以twisted特別針對jython環境做了安全執行緒處理。

Python合并兩個numpy矩陣__Python

原文:http://www.cnblogs.com/itdyb/p/5735911.html numpy是Python用來科學計算的一個非常重要的庫,numpy主要用來處理一些矩陣對象,可以說numpy讓Python有了Matlab的味道。實際的應用中,矩陣的合并是一個經常發生的操作,如何利用numpy來合并兩個矩陣呢。我們可以利用numpy向我們提供的兩個函數來進行操作。 首先我們先隨機的產生兩個矩陣 import numpy as np###矩陣aa=np.floor(10

python基本 if和function__python

From:http://www.liaoxuefeng.com/wiki/001374738125095c955c1e6d8bb493182103fac9270762a000/00137473843313062a8b0e7c19b40aa8f31bdc4db5f6498000 if 語句文法: if <條件判斷1>: <執行1>elif <條件判斷2>: <執行2>elif <條件判斷3>:

python 匿名函數——lamda

摘要:你是不是不經常遇到這樣的情景:需要使用一個函數,但功能非常簡單,而且僅僅會臨時使用一次,不想汙染命名空間。如果你經常碰到這種需求,或者在python中看到lamda運算式,本文就與你一起探討lamda運算式。 1.什麼是lamda運算式 Python 支援一種有趣的文法,它允許你快速定義單行的最小函數。這些叫做 lambda 的函數,是從 Lisp 借用來的,可以用在任何需要函數的地方。 >>> def

python 各類型資料儲存__python

原文地址:http://www.cnblogs.com/pzxbc/archive/2012/03/18/2404715.html 在實驗過程中,我們會有各種類型的資料產生。為了節約時間,提高效率,通常會將資料進行儲存,然後再讀取。這裡提供一種方式能夠儲存多種類型的資料。

python 偏函數應用

摘要:python的設計核心原則就是簡潔——在這種原則的指導下,誕生了lambda運算式和偏函數:二者都讓函數調用變得簡潔。本文主要為你介紹偏函數的應用。 1.為什麼要使用偏函數 如果我們定義了一個函數,比如說將四個數相加add(one

總頁數: 2974 1 .... 453 454 455 456 457 .... 2974 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.